Output 66386915517acf8d5808551fb00f7c70b2fe9a6885fe157704e6c74e9ef981d0:26

value
1154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21ee946c4c56590a7e376ea9cdbd32d8178a51a65c58733807aa5170805da032
address
bc1py8hfgmzv2evs5l3hd65um0fjmqtc55dxt3v8xwq84fghpqza5qeqrnwzcr
transaction
66386915517acf8d5808551fb00f7c70b2fe9a6885fe157704e6c74e9ef981d0
spent
true